Caitlin Clark continues climb in WNBA player power rankings

Caitlin Clark is having a banner year with the Indiana Fever

Clark is averaging 22.1 points, 8.3 assists and 3.8 rebounds per game. That's helped her get the Fever to where they need to be with a 25-14 record and trip to the playoffs in hand.

Now, Clark is getting recognized as one of the best in the WNBA. In ESPN's August WNBA player rankings, out on Thursday, Clark is No. 2 on the list. That's up from No. 3 in July. The only player she's behind is A'ja Wilson of the Las Vegas Aces.

Caitlin Clark keeps climbing the WNBA rankings

"Clark ranks No. 3 in the league in points per game, No. 1 in assists, tied with Alyssa Thomas, and her gravity has helped Kelsey Mitchell and Aliyah Boston have career seasons," Kareem Copeland of ESPN notes in the feature. "The streak ended over the weekend, but Clark recently tied her own WNBA record with six consecutive games of 20-plus points and five-plus assists."

"She also set a career high with eight 3-pointers in a game last week, moving past Diana Taurasi into second place in WNBA history for most career 3-point field goals during a player's first three seasons."

So, there are plenty of reasons for Clark to be named one of the very best in the WNBA. What could give her the edge to make it to No. 1? She basically just needs to keep doing what she's doing. It'll also help if she leads the Fever deep into the playoffs.
